I graduated from IUP (Indiana University of Pennsylvania) in 1977 with a BS degree in Art Education. I have utilized that education to do things such as creating all of the graphics that I employ on my website, MotherBedford.com. That means that when you visit that website, every background image, every button, every line and every icon was created by me. Since I have collected antiques since I was five or six, a good portion of the graphic images for my website comes from my personal collection. I have also always been interested in writing, and so the website provides an outlet for my studies in history. My third great love in life is genealogy and family history. The MotherBedford website is a mix of all those things: my art and writing, and my love of history, both genealogical and regional.
